「软件开发的多学科融合」-合其家
软件开发是当今世界上最热门的行业之一,涉及到计算机编程、软件设计、软件测试等多个方面。在这个行业中,程序员们使用编程语言和软件工具来创建新的软件程序,这些软件可以用于各种领域,例如商业、医疗、教育、交通等等。本文将探讨软件开发的各个方面,包括编程语言、软件开发流程、软件工程和软件开发工具等。
编程语言是软件开发过程中非常重要的一部分。编程语言是程序员使用的语言,用于描述软件程序的功能和实现。不同的编程语言适用于不同的领域和任务,例如Java适用于商业应用程序,Python适用于数据科学和机器学习等。选择适合项目的编程语言可以帮助程序员更高效地开发软件,同时也可以更好地与其他人合作。
软件开发流程是一个系统化的过程,用于创建新的软件程序。软件开发流程通常包括需求分析、设计、开发、测试和部署等步骤。不同的软件项目可能需要不同的开发流程,但是大多数软件开发流程都包括这些步骤。在软件开发过程中,程序员需要与其他团队成员合作,例如产品经理、设计师、测试人员等。通过沟通和协作,开发人员可以更好地理解需求,设计出更好的软件,并确保软件在测试和部署过程中取得成功。
软件工程是软件开发过程中的一个重要方面,用于确保软件的质量和可维护性。软件工程包括软件开发的各个方面,例如软件设计、软件测试、软件部署和软件维护等。软件工程师使用各种工具和技术来管理软件开发过程,以确保软件的质量和可靠性。软件工程师需要了解用户需求和软件设计原则,并使用测试和质量保证工具来检查软件的性能和可靠性。
最后,软件开发工具是软件开发过程中非常重要的一部分。软件开发工具用于帮助程序员更高效地开发软件,例如代码编辑器、编译器、调试器等。软件开发工具还可以帮助程序员更轻松地管理和维护软件,例如版本控制工具和代码审查工具等。
软件开发是当今世界上最热门的行业之一,涉及到多个方面,包括编程语言、软件开发流程、软件工程和软件开发工具等。通过了解这些方面的知识,程序员可以更好地开发软件,并确保软件的质量和可靠性。